photo of Robert AronsonRobert Aronson is a nationally recognized expert in professional responsibility, ethics, evidence, criminal law, and sports law. He has published five books on professional responsibility, including a law school text, and his book, The Law of Evidence in Washington, is one of the leading treatises on the subject. He joined the UW law school faculty in 1975. A former president of the Pac-10 Athletic Conference and chair of its Compliance & Enforcement Committee, he currently serves on the editorial board of the International Journal of Criminal Law Education and the Washington State Bar Access to Justice Committee. He has been a commissioner on Uniform State Laws, chaired the Washington Appellate Defender Association, and served on the Washington State Legislative Ethics Board.
